Workplace Experience Coordinator

Host is a service line of CBRE, the world's largest commercial real estate organization.
Our mission is to increase individual well-being, personal productivity and organizational effectiveness through people-led, technology-enabled services.
Put simply:
our goal is to help people work smarter and delight in doing it.
Our experience offering connects employees to their environments - via technology, amenities, and communities that matter the most.
Host's scalable product suite includes concierge-quality services provided by dedicated CBRE hosts; world-class customer service training and certification; and a powerful, enterprise-grade technology platform.
The platform, which can be tailored to specific client requirements, features a robust mobile experience that allows users to navigate the workplace, schedule meetings with colleagues, reserve workspaces, use food and beverage services, and access building and concierge services.
The Workplace Experience Coordinator role is at the forefront of delivering a positive, best-in-class office experience as a cultural ambassador, community advocate, and service leader.
As part of a front-of-house team, you will be responsible for providing excellent service and crafting a comfortable atmosphere by greeting visitors while supporting all employee-facing services.
What You'll Do:
Greets employees and announces clients and visitors.
Issues visitor passes and validates parking.
Receives and transfers incoming calls to appropriate parties.
Provides coordination and support for delivery of workplace services like Concierge, Reception, Switchboard, and Room Management.
A/V Support, Meeting and event management, Supply and Expense Management, Meeting, and events coordination Equipment Care, etc.
Maintains awareness of the workspace.
Submits janitorial and maintenance work orders as needed and/or connects with appropriate partners to address issues.
Responds to customer requests and complaints with accurate and detailed information according to specific request.
Follows security and emergency procedures as defined for the property.
Responds to emergencies in a calm, efficient manner.
Acquires appropriate assistance and makes appropriate notifications by operating procedures.
Maintains records of vendor proof of insurance and contractual documentation in place, per requirements.
Collaborates with vendors employees who provide services and goods.
Delivers orientations, such as tours of facility, how to submit a workorder, where supplies are kept and ordering procedure, amenities, and software ordering.
Provides overview of Host Experience service.
Assists in the completion of the Service Business Continuity plan.
May support coordination of moves, adds, and changes (MAC).
Performs other duties as assigned.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
